Transaction 4d80c59856e757de2fff9695b462a4e4307a44494e1c869fbb87af2b3de88322

1 Input
2 Outputs
  • 4d80c59856e757de2fff9695b462a4e4307a44494e1c869fbb87af2b3de88322:0
  • value  601026
    address  15hucVrVi4Dz8rHvujixraQ5CEB4S4VLk5
  • 4d80c59856e757de2fff9695b462a4e4307a44494e1c869fbb87af2b3de88322:1
  • value  581518452
    address  3QzvrUx2E2acc3VjM3wa4eDAmwPLpBcZen